Biography

2018-19: First-Team all-UAA ... Set the Bears all-time three-point field goals made record on Sunday, Jan. 27 during an 82-79 win over Case Western Reserve passing Kelly Manning (192: 2002-06) for first all-time on the career list, ending the game with 195 total ... Concluded career with a program record 220 three-pointers ... Bears second leading scorer averaging 9.4 points per game ... Second in the UAA with 64 three-pointers made ... Finished with the eighth best three-point field goal percentage in the UAA, 35.0-percent ... Reached double figures in scoring 13 times on the season ... Converted 4-of-10 three-pointers in the NCAA Sectional Final, scoring 16 points to help the Bears keep pace with Thomas More on March 9 ... Twice scored a season-high 20 points, first on Jan. 25 versus Carnegie Mellon and secondly on Feb. 17 against Brandeis ... Named the UAA Athlete of the Week on Jan. 28 ... Academic all-UAA.

2017-18: Averaged 29.6 minutes in 26 games started scoring 12.1 points and grabbing 3.3 rebounds per game ... Shot 44.1 percent from three-point range (79-179) converting the second most treys in a single season in school history with the fifth best percentage on a minimum of 50 attempted ... Enters senior season ranking third all-time in three-pointers made with 156 while holding the top three-point field goal percentage (42.4) ... Scored a season-high 23 points at Chicago on 8-of-14 shooting, including 6-of-10 from beyond the arc ... Dished out a season-best six assists against Oglethorpe during the 17th Annual McWilliams Classic on Dec. 1 ... Drained a closing second go-ahead three-pointer against DePauw to help the Bears win the Midwest Classic on Nov. 26 ... Second team all-UAA.

2016-17: Appeared in all 29 games as a sophmore ... Averaged 6.9 points and 1.7 rebounds per game ... Scored in double-figures six times ... Lead the team in three-point-feild goals made with 53, the ninth most ever recorded at Wash U. in a single season ... Finished third in the UAA in three-point feild goal percentage (.396) ... Scored a season-high 20 points on 6-of-11 three-point shooting and pulled in a career high six rebounds vs. Emory (2/10).

2015-16: Appeared in 18 off the bench averaging 5.7 points per game ... Second on the team in three-point field-goal percentage (.436) and fourth in three-pointers made (24) ... Scored in double figures three times, including season-high 23 points on 7-of-9 three-point shooting at No. 1 Thomas More in NCAA Sectional Championship (3/12) ... UAA Athlete of the Week March 14. 

HIGH SCHOOL: Four-year letterwinner in basketball and volleyball at Webster Groves High School ... Team captain in basketball ... Averaged 12.3 points and 4.9 rebounds as a freshman ... Teams recorded a 75-36 record in four seasons, including a 19-9 mark as a senior ... 2014 Conference champions ... Two-time First-team all-conference and all-district ... Academic all-state ... St. Louis Post Dispatch Scholar Athlete ... National Honor Society ... Graduated summa cum laude.

PERSONAL: Double majoring in systems engineering and operations & supply chain management ... Daughter of Michael and Melissa Sondag.
